Transaction 32ac966dc770bfcb3e7bc569ca82f190f8e5f65c418c9d27ecb2c58df5b41b63

1 Input
2 Outputs
  • 32ac966dc770bfcb3e7bc569ca82f190f8e5f65c418c9d27ecb2c58df5b41b63:0
  • value  5366894
    address  1AeMfCR2FChEcuBAU1Y4D2iz6qsvJeVs21
  • 32ac966dc770bfcb3e7bc569ca82f190f8e5f65c418c9d27ecb2c58df5b41b63:1
  • value  346663536
    address  1D1aGAYEbwvDqYgdpW2TSj7MsURLWWG9Bn